Sergey Bugaev e7e179212c HackStudio: Send an open file to language servers
Language servers will now receive an open file instead of just its path. This
means the language servers no longer need to access the filesystem to open the
file themselves.

The C++ language server now has no filesystem access whatsoever (although we
might need to relax this in the future if it learns to complete #include paths),
while the Shell language server can read /etc/passwd (it wants that in order to
get the user's home directory) and browse (but not read!) the whole file system
tree for completing paths.

#include "LanguageClient.h"
#include <AK/String.h>
#include <AK/Vector.h>
namespace HackStudio {
void ServerConnection::handle(const Messages::LanguageClient::AutoCompleteSuggestions& message)
{
if (m_language_client)
m_language_client->provide_autocomplete_suggestions(message.suggestions());
}
void LanguageClient::open_file(const String& path, int fd)
{
m_connection.post_message(Messages::LanguageServer::FileOpened(path, fd));
}
void LanguageClient::set_file_content(const String& path, const String& content)
{
m_connection.post_message(Messages::LanguageServer::SetFileContent(path, content));
}
void LanguageClient::insert_text(const String& path, const String& text, size_t line, size_t column)
{
m_connection.post_message(Messages::LanguageServer::FileEditInsertText(path, text, line, column));
}
void LanguageClient::remove_text(const String& path, size_t from_line, size_t from_column, size_t to_line, size_t to_column)
{
m_connection.post_message(Messages::LanguageServer::FileEditRemoveText(path, from_line, from_column, to_line, to_column));
}
void LanguageClient::request_autocomplete(const String& path, size_t cursor_line, size_t cursor_column)
{
m_connection.post_message(Messages::LanguageServer::AutoCompleteSuggestions(path, cursor_line, cursor_column));
}
void LanguageClient::provide_autocomplete_suggestions(const Vector<AutoCompleteResponse>& suggestions)
{
if (on_autocomplete_suggestions)
on_autocomplete_suggestions(suggestions);
// Otherwise, drop it on the floor :shrug:
}
}
